The Essence of Indian Cuisine


Indian food is built on a foundation of spices, but spices are used not just for heat—rather to create layers of flavor. Turmeric adds earthiness, cumin brings warmth, coriander adds citrusy freshness, and garam masala provides deep, complex notes. Each spice blend varies from region to region, creating distinctive taste profiles.


Indian cuisine also values balance. Most meals include a mix of textures and flavors—creamy, crunchy, spicy, sweet, sour, and smoky—often all on the same plate. This balance is especially visible in dishes like Palak Paneer, where smooth spinach gravy pairs beautifully with soft paneer cubes, or Chicken Tikka Masala, where smoky grilled chicken absorbs the richness of a velvety tomato-based sauce.


Must-Try Indian Dishes Loved Worldwide


1. Chicken Tikka Masala


Arguably one of the most famous Indian dishes globally, Chicken Tikka Masala is a perfect blend of smoky grilled chicken pieces simmered in a flavorful tomato, butter, and cream sauce. Its bright orange color, creamy texture, and mildly spiced flavor make it a universal favorite. Whether enjoyed with warm naan or basmati rice, this dish embodies the comfort and indulgence of Indian cooking.


2. Palak Paneer


A classic North Indian dish, Palak Paneer features tender cottage cheese cubes in a thick, vibrant green spinach gravy. Seasoned with garlic, cumin, and aromatic spices, this dish is both nutritious and incredibly flavorful. It pairs beautifully with roti, paratha, or rice. Palak Paneer showcases how Indian cuisine balances health and taste effortlessly.

Exploring India’s Regional Specialties


Indian cuisine is not a single style—it’s a collection of diverse regional traditions shaped by geography, climate, and culture. Here are some highlights:


North India

North Indian food is hearty, creamy, and rich in dairy. Popular dishes include butter chicken, naan, dal makhani, and of course, parathas. Punjab and Delhi are famous for tandoori cooking, where meats and breads are cooked in a clay oven, giving them a smoky flavor.


South India

In South India, rice is the star. Dishes like dosa, idli, sambar, and biryani define the region’s cuisine. Coconut, curry leaves, mustard seeds, and tamarind are widely used. The flavors are bold, tangy, and often spicy.


East India

Eastern Indian cuisine highlights subtle flavors, seafood, and sweets. Bengal is famous for fish curries and desserts like rasgulla and sandesh. Mustard oil and poppy seeds are essential in this region.


West India

Western Indian food varies dramatically—from the spicy curries of Goa influenced by Portuguese cuisine to the vegetarian dishes of Gujarat and the beach-inspired flavors of Maharashtra. Pav bhaji, dhokla, and Goan vindaloo are some iconic dishes.
